There exists such a huge variety of different kinds of forklifts on the market. Amongst the first factors you have to make when you are planning to buy one is whether or not the equipment is of good quality. For instance, if the lift truck is used or second hand, there are other things to look at more carefully than if you are buying brand new.
Your available funds would also determine how much of your expenses would be spent on a new or used lift truck. Your operating expense can also determine things like the batteries, the fuel type, the oil and maintenance budget for the machinery. The second thing to think about is where precisely do you foresee utilizing the machinery? Will you be working inside or outside or both? The specific types of work you will be doing and the loads that the truck would carry, along with the number of working hours in a week or days would all play a part in knowing what kind of forklift would best meet your specific needs. Choosing the most effective and longest lasting lift truck available within your budget will be the right thing to do.
Be sure that when you purchase a forklift for an industrial or warehouse atmosphere that the vehicle is capable of providing a safe work platform for those working personnel in close proximity. It is vital to keep all employees, close passerby's and the heavy supplies safe at all times during operation.
When in the market for the brand new lift truck, make sure that you have checked the manufacturing parameters and the make of the equipment. Like for instance, if there are 2 similar brand names available on the market, be sure to do some research compare their effectiveness and also check out their competitive pricing and research its certain specifications before choosing one. One more great idea is to arrange for one whole day test drive if possible. Drive the demo vehicle you are considering purchasing to be able to see how effectively it suits your particular needs.
There are several things to take into account when thinking about a lift truck purchase. Deciding on new or used units; factors like lifting capacity, tire type, and model is also going to really affect the overall cost you would pay. What's more, you should decide if an Electric Lift Truck that operates on battery power and is right to be used inside as it has zero emissions, or if an IC Forklift, operating on gasoline, diesel, Liquid Propane or compressed natural gas and used outside would be more suitable. Each jobsite has its own specific requirements and these should be considered so as to find the right machine for you.
